    SK/CLR/ENC is a good trio for grinding, and as you suggested, DPS is going to be the issue. The good news is that when Luclin comes out Dire Charm will be a pretty nice low maintenance source of DPS through GoD in places like PoFire and CoD. Once OoW comes out you'll be harder pressed to find ways to make charm be very useful.

    The easiest boxes to add for DPS are Mage, Necro, Wiz and Ranger once you get the archery AAs. The determining factor will be what set of secondary skills you want to add to the group...CotH, ports, track, another rezzer, etc. Whichever toon you can adopt for free from a guildie is probably the best choice.

  7. HoodenShuklak Augur

    I'm partial to bard, but I would do bard for a low-effort:high-payoff box... or a high high effort shaman box. Both classes offer slow, which is absolutely critical to most bosses, but the shaman's toolkit gets much better post-LDON than a bard. Pre-LDON, it's not a stretch at all to say the bard is a better slower in many situations, given their negative resist check AE slow.

    Next, I would add a plate tank, either an SK or WAR, depending on how good a tank you want (you kill old bosses) vs better DPS in a group. Paladin isn't a good option since you're a main cleric.

    I did a CLR/WIZ/BRD trio on Agnarr and it was pretty solid. For example, I was able to do stuff like 3 box Vox in Luclin but if I had a warrior tank I probably could have been on another level since I enjoyed killing old bosses more than group stuff, and that's where a warrior shines. Nothing really compares to a defensive warrior.

    You could also go crazy and be a CLR tank with 2 supports. The CLR summon hammer procs like mad and they get a reactive nuke buff which is solid in a few expansions. It's a very different style, but interesting. I was able to handily tank Seru on Selo as a cleric.
